Chinese brand Honor debuted its Robot Phone on the opening red carpet of the Shanghai International Film Festival, a device combining AI interaction with a high-resolution camera that extends from the phone body like an antenna, moves on its own, and retracts when not in use. The phone served as the festival’s official imaging partner. Ellemen, Shanghai IFF’s official fashion and lifestyle partner magazine, used it to shoot short films featuring the 21 Golden Goblet jury members, headed by Tony Leung Chiu-wai, and covered the red carpet, opening night banquet, and backstage moments. The Robot Phone marks Honor’s first collaboration with Arri, the global cinematic camera technology company. Its capabilities include all-angle AI video calls that track the user through robotic motion control and a three-axis gimbal stabilization system. “Today, consumer smartphones have already become a serious tool in professional filmmaking, being used on blockbusters across the globe. That’s why we believe it is time to bring these worlds even closer together,” said David Bermbach, Arri’s managing director. Honor announced in May at Cannes that the phone would go on sale to the public in Q3.
